**2018**

- [3125822-002](https://wulfkaal.github.io/claims/3125822-002) [failure/asserted] *(failure mode)* -- Reputation value in any decentralized reputational system can be corrupted through three channels: direct purchase of reputation, automated worthless work, and degeneration of the system into a majority of inexpert opinions.
  > In any such decentralized reputational system there is always the potential to corrupt the value of reputation by purchasing it directly, or through automated worthless work, or through the degeneration of a majority of inexpert opinions.
  Craig Calcaterra, Wulf A. Kaal, Vlad Andrei, Blockchain Infrastructure for Measuring Domain Specific Reputation in Autonomous Decentralized and A (2018). SSRN: https://ssrn.com/abstract=3125822

**2019**

- [3406323-038](https://wulfkaal.github.io/claims/3406323-038) [failure/asserted] *(failure mode)* -- Without a core common ethical denominator, decentralized systems cannot last: they lose coherence, become attackable, and can be corrupted, leading to suboptimal societal outcomes.
  > Without a core common ethical denominator, decentralized systems cannot last, they lose coherence, become attackable, and can be corrupted, leading to suboptimal societal outcomes.
  Wulf A. Kaal, Decentralization - A Primer on the New Economy (2019). SSRN: https://ssrn.com/abstract=3406323

**2021**

- [3808873-032](https://wulfkaal.github.io/claims/3808873-032) [mechanism/argued] *(failure mode)* -- An algorithmic future in which most human decisions are predicted or performed by algorithms threatens human individuality, and the resulting loss of diversity of human experience and of unpredictability threatens the diversity of nodes in decentralized systems.
  > An algorithmic future where most of humans' decisions are predicted and or performed by algorithms creates a threat for human individuality. The lack of diversity of human experiences and lacking unpredictability create a threat to diversity of nodes in decentralized systems.
  Wulf A. Kaal, Decentralization Neutralizers (2021). SSRN: https://ssrn.com/abstract=3808873
